Ranking of Utah Cities and Places By Percentage of Population with Ethiopian Ancestry in 2021
Updated on April 16, 2025.
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, there were 1.01K people in Utah with Ethiopian ancestry (0.03% of Utah population). Among all Utah cities and places with a population of at least 10K, South Salt Lake city had the highest percentage of its population with Ethiopian ancestry (0.50%), followed by Millcreek city (0.28%), and Woods Cross city (0.17%).

| Rank | Ciy or Place | Percentage of Pop. (%) |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| South Salt Lake city | 0.50 |
| 2 | Millcreek city | 0.28 |
| 3 | Woods Cross city | 0.17 |
| 4 | Salt Lake City city | 0.14 |
| 5 | West Valley City city | 0.12 |
| 6 | Clinton city | 0.09 |
| 7 | St. George city | 0.07 |
| 8 | Centerville city | 0.05 |
| 8 | Layton city | 0.05 |
| 9 | Bountiful city | 0.04 |
